On the 10th Sha’baan 1433 / 30th June 2012 our Shaykh Ahmad ‘Umar Bazmool (حفظه الله تعالى) delivered a beneficial advice to some youth who had come from the UK to make Umrah.
In this lecture the Shaykh mentioned from amongst other things, the following:
- The commandment of asking the people of knowledge if you do not know.
- The obligation of seeking knowledge to remove ignorance
- The importance of being kind to your parents, not even saying “uff” to them
- Taking care of the parents in old age and seeking their forgiveness
- Being patient with Allah’s decree and not using it as an excuse to justify his sinning
- Do an action to the best of your ability in matters of religion and worldly matters
- Defending the status of women in Islam, responding to false accusations
- The plots of Shaytaan, the enemy of the believers…
The advice was concluded with the children being given the opportunity to get any questions they had answered by the Shaykh.
